North Carolina's incredible variety of hiking trails range from the sands of Cape Hatteras to the majestic Great Smoky Mountains. Veteran hiker Allen de hart knows them all, and for many years has compiled the most comprehensive, authoritative trail information for the entire state. This all-new third edition thoroughly updates de Hart's popular and superlative guide - the best information on North Carolina hiking available. This edition includes exhaustively revised and updated descriptions of more than 900 trails; trail length, difficulty, elevation changes, connecting trails, landmarks, scenery, local wildlife, support facilities, precautions, and special features of each trail; clear and concise directions to trailheads; four color maps on two pull-out sheets showing the locations of all trails. Allen de Hart has been hiking, designing, and constructing trails, and writing about hiking for five decades. He has hiked more than 29,000 miles on 12,000 trails in the U.S. and 18 foreign countries. Off the trail he is a professor emeritus of history and special advisor to the president on cultural affairs at Louisburg College in Lousiburg, North Carolina.
